Mimi Fürst has a diverse work experience background with a focus on design and animation. Mimi currently works as a UX Designer at Toca Boca since August 2021. Prior to this, they worked as a UI/UX Designer at Goodbye Kansas Group from January 2021 to July 2021. Mimi also worked as a UI/UX Designer at Sprung Studios - UX/UI Design from May 2019 to December 2020.

In terms of their animation experience, Mimi worked as a Scouts' Oath at Vancouver Film School from November 2018 to April 2019, where they were involved in developing the art style, creating concept art, and animating characters. Mimi also worked as a Prop Artist and Level Designer for the game JetRabbit at the same institution from September 2018 to October 2018, where they created concept art and designed low-poly props.

Mimi has also contributed to the education field. Mimi worked as an Animation Guest Teacher and Supervisor at Stockholm Academy of Dramatic Arts from January 2016 to March 2018, teaching animation and puppet making and mentoring students. Additionally, they worked as an Animation Substitute Teacher at Animationsakademien during the same period.

During their freelance period from 2015 to 2017, Mimi took on various projects as a Freelancing Animator and Illustrator. Mimi worked on projects such as background projections for the touring band "The Forbidden Orchestra," stop motion animated information films for RFSU (The Swedish Association for Sexuality Education), and developed the indie game project "Smelly Memories" with a small team. Mimi also developed the game "Smelly Memories/Stinkande Minnen," a stop motion animated point and click game, where they also acted as an illustrator.

Furthermore, Mimi worked as an illustrator for the book series "Dead Animals/Döda djur" published by Pionier Press in 2014. Mimi also had an internship at DOCKHUS ANIMATION AB, where they worked on the animated children feature film and TV-show "Tänk om..." from September 2013 to November 2013.

Mimi Fürst's education history begins in 2010 when they attended Södertörn University for Literature Studies and Creative Writing. Mimi completed their studies there in 2011. Following that, from 2012 to 2015, they pursued a Bachelor of Fine Arts degree in Animated Film at the Stockholm Academy of Dramatic Arts. Finally, in 2018, Mimi enrolled at Vancouver Film School, where they obtained a Game Design Diploma, specializing in Game Design, in 2019.
